Hello
My daughter was born in Northern Ireland and I want to confirm if she’s eligible for British passport

My wife is an Irish national living in Northern Ireland her parents are also Irish. I am non EU living in Northern Ireland and my parents are non EU living in Asia

Based on this is my daughter eligible to apply for a British passport?
I tried doing passport application online but it keeps asking for my daughters grandparents birth certificates and marriage certificate (cannot get it as my parents are divorced)

How do I go about getting her British passport?
